你查询的IP:[60.230.10.159]  地理位置:澳大利亚Telstra网络

最新查询119.108.23.200 122.64.8.184 118.132.103.166 59.80.131.49 118.72.56.192 124.220.251.205 61.236.99.98 122.198.250.241 119.20.192.14 60.230.10.159 202.122.32.188 116.52.113.167 202.122.128.116 202.4.128.103 202.20.120.143 221.12.128.38 202.14.236.249 121.101.208.187 119.48.203.242 119.164.229.73 61.128.126.130 61.47.128.168 221.192.126.149 116.198.25.30 116.193.16.131 118.244.172.250 61.87.192.124 210.51.208.3 210.15.23.29 202.170.216.180 116.58.208.84